GOSHEN, Ind. - The Huntington softball team didn't have an answer for the Maple Leafs' hot bats to suffer a pair of losses, 15-3, 9-4, to Goshen (12-18, 6-7) Friday afternoon at the Ingold Athletic Complex.

After two scoreless innings in the opener, the wheels fell off in the third when the hosts pieced together six hits, including a three-run dinger, and took advantage of an HU error and four walks to erupt for eight runs. It was the beginning of the end as the Maple Leafs reeled off seven more runs in the fourth to put the game out of reach. It was the fourth time this year Goshen has reached double digit runs.
